Rep. Nancy Mace Leads Fight to Protect Women's Sports at U.S. Service Academies
Rep. Nancy Mace, R-South Carolina, has submitted an amendment to the National Defense Authorization Act (NDAA) to protect female athletes and keep men out of women's sports at U.S. Service Academies. The amendment defines female and male by biological reality, not ideology, and puts athletic eligibility back on the side of science. Rep. Mace's efforts aim to protect women's rights, defend fairness in athletics, and demand accountability in federal policy.
Key Takeaways:
- Rep. Mace's amendment makes it clear that the Superintendent of a Service Academy cannot allow male cadets or midshipmen to compete in athletic programs reserved exclusively for women.
- The amendment is based on President Trump's executive order Defending Women From Gender Ideology Extremism and Restoring Biological Truth, which extends to U.S. Service Academies.
